Ashcroft Low Pressure Gauge

Ashcroft Low Pressure Gauge
  • # 2½" and 3½" dial size
  • # Glass-filled polysulfone case material
  • # Beryllium copper diaphragm
  • # Brass Socket
  • # Wetted materials of beryllium copper, brass, polysulfone and RTV silicone


The Ashcroft® Type 1490 low pressure diaphragm gauge is designed to measure pressure from 10 in.H2O to 15psi, both positive and negative pressures. This gauge uses a very sensitive diaphragm capsule to measure low pressure and vacuum.

The gauge is specifically designed for use whenever the pressure medium is a gas that is not corrosive to beryllium copper, brass, polysulfone and RTV silicone. Typical applications are, but not limited to, vacuum pumps, gas leak detectors, air compressors, air filters, gas burners, gas measurement, vacuum ovens, suction regulators and respirators.
